Glenda Neal Lawter
CHESNEE, SC-- Mrs. Glenda Anne Neal Lawter, 73, of 658 Davis Trading Post Road, Chesnee, passed away Sunday 24, 2012. Born, August 31, 1938 in Woodruff, she was the loving wife of Dean Lawter and the daughter of the late James Davenport and Velma Hanna Dupree. She was owner and operator of a Bar and Grill, loved knitting, canning, and spending time with her family, and was of the Baptist faith.
She is survived by her son, Fredric "Ricky" Banks II and his wife Robin Ann of Cowpens; one brother, Marshall Davenport; two sisters, Judy Edwards and her husband Charles of Rockwell, NC and Peggy Lee and her husband Darrell of Harmony, NC; four grandchildren, Fredric "Ricky" Banks III and his wife Cassandra, James Christopher Banks and his wife Christina, Summer Rochelle Banks, and Leslie Mills; four great-grandchildren, JT Banks, Mackenzie Banks, Katie Satterfield and Alex Satterfield; and one aunt, Mildred Landford.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her brother, Donald "Billy" Davenport.
The family will receive friends on Wednesday, June 27, 2012 from 12:00 pm until 2:00 pm at Eggers Funeral Home of Chesnee. Funeral services will follow at 2:00 pm in Eggers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Allen Dean Blanton officiating. Interment will be in Springhill Memorial Gardens.
